And one question about pinuots why you named gpio01 as 18 or i dont understand how it work?
I am not the author of this project, but I think it's because on ESP32 module some GPIO pins are already assigned for other functions in default.
- GPIO 1: UART0 Tx
- GPIO 3: UART0 Rx
- GPIO 11: Connected to the SCS pin of internal flash (inside ESP32-WROOM-32 module)
Ref: ESP32-WROOM-32 Datasheet -- 6. Schemetics
I think that's why these 3 channels must use other pins.
I have tried to make this project work on ESP32DevKit and ESP32S2. It needs major modifications to work on S3 or C3. I have abandoned my efforts but will share some points:
- sigrok-cli scans at 115200, so setting this as the baud rate allows PulseView to detect it at connection
- the program hangs if dma does not complete: Line 268 :
while (! s_state->dma_done )
delay(100);
- ledcSetup() needs attention. There is no error checking, and if it fails, then there is no CLK and the capture will not complete. ledcSetup() returns 0, or the freq achieved. If it is zero, then the bitsize and duty need to be adjusted until a valid frequency is returned. https://espressif-docs.readthedocs-hosted.com/projects/arduino-esp32/en/latest/api/ledc.html

Thanks @ozarchie . Indeed problem is; after years Espressif IDF looks like does not accept/support ledc output pin as i2s clk input pin, directly. You need to define another pin and need physically connect those 2 pins. Afterwards, program will be work.
I have released another version. Fixed many things. But no not make any test with C3 or S2 - S3... AFAIK, S3 doesn't have I2S camera input support. So might be not possible to support it. I do not have S2 or S3 but have C3 chip. Will try to support it.
I look at C3 and... I don't say that it's not possible but... Not compatible with current code. Also there are some issues with C3's I2S DMA RX operation, located at here: https://github.com/espressif/arduino-esp32/issues/7648 . I think it's not worth to work for support it.
